  2. General Description. The MAX6950/MAX6951 are compact common-cathode display drivers that interface microprocessors to individ-ual 7-segment numeric LED digits, bar graph, or discrete LEDs through an SPITM-, QSPITM-, MICROWIRETM-com-patible serial interface. The supply voltage can be as low as 2.7V.

  5. Jul 17, 2002 · The MAX6950 and MAX6951 are five-digit and eight-digit common-cathode LED display drivers that use an unusual multiplexing scheme. This multiplexing scheme minimizes the connections between the driver and the LED display, but requires the segment connections to be different to each of the five (MAX6950) or eight (MAX6951) digits (Table 1).
